Asphalt Parking Lot Paving in Little Rock, AR
Asphalt parking lot paving services involve the installation, repair, and resurfacing of asphalt surfaces designed for vehicle parking. These projects typically include creating new parking areas, expanding existing lots, or restoring worn or damaged surfaces. Property owners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, ensure safe and smooth access for vehicles, and enhance the overall functionality of their property. Before requesting paving work, it’s useful to understand the size of the area, any existing surface conditions, and specific requirements such as drainage or accessibility features.
Homeowners and property owners should also consider factors like the intended use of the parking lot, local climate conditions, and long-term maintenance needs. Clear communication about the scope of the project helps ensure the finished surface meets expectations for durability and safety. Proper planning can prevent future issues such as cracking, potholes, or uneven surfaces, making asphalt paving a practical investment for maintaining a well-kept and accessible property.

Common Asphalt Parking Lot Paving Jobs
Commercial parking lot paving - designed to create durable and smooth surfaces for customer and employee parking.
Residential driveway paving - enhances curb appeal and provides a reliable surface for daily vehicle use.
Overlay and resurfacing - restores aging asphalt to improve appearance and extend pavement life.
New asphalt installation - suitable for constructing fresh parking areas on new or existing properties.
Repair and patchwork - addresses cracks, potholes, and surface damage to maintain safety and functionality.
Seal coating services - protects asphalt surfaces from weather and wear, helping to prolong their lifespan.
Asphalt Parking Lot Paving Questions
What types of parking lot surfaces can be paved? Asphalt paving is suitable for various surfaces, including existing lots needing resurfacing or new installations for commercial and residential properties.
How does asphalt paving improve a parking lot? It provides a smooth, durable surface that can enhance the appearance and functionality of a property’s parking area.
What should property owners consider before paving? Proper assessment of the current surface, drainage needs, and future traffic expectations help ensure a long-lasting result.
Are repairs needed after asphalt paving? Regular maintenance, such as sealing cracks and resealing, helps extend the lifespan of the paved surface.
